Top Smartphone Accessories: Analysis of Sales Data and Popularity Rankings

Hey there! So, when you're picking out smartphone accessories, you might want to pay attention to things like sales data and popularity rankings. It really can make a difference in what you choose. A recent report from Grand View Research says that the whole smartphone accessories market is set to hit a whopping $105 billion by 2025! Can you believe that? It's mainly because more people are getting smartphones and they're looking for high-quality gear to go with them. Right at the top of the list are protective cases and screen protectors. They make up more than a quarter of the market, which just shows how vital they are for keeping our devices safe.

On the charging side of things, accessories like wireless chargers and power banks are really starting to take off. The market's expected to grow at about 13.2% a year through 2024! According to the Consumer Technology Association, around 70% of smartphone users think that fast charging is super important when they're buying accessories. With everyone wanting to get things done quickly and conveniently, demand for those multi-functional chargers is skyrocketing. So, if a brand can come up with something innovative in that area, they could really see some great market gains!

And let’s not forget audio accessories. True wireless earbuds have been on fire lately! Sales shot up over 60% just in the last year, based on data from Statista. This is part of a larger shift towards wireless tech, as people crave more freedom and ease in their daily lives. Brands that can deliver great sound quality along with a stylish look are really hitting the mark. They’re keeping themselves ahead in the accessories game for sure!

The Impact of Brand Loyalty on Accessory Choices and Purchases

You know, brand loyalty really makes a difference in what we choose to buy, especially when it comes to things like smartphone accessories. A study from Statista found that a whopping 73% of people are more likely to grab accessories from brands they already own. Isn’t that interesting? It shows there’s this solid link between the brand of our primary device and what we go for in accessories. Basically, when we invest in a smartphone, we’re also on the lookout for those cool add-ons that go well with the brands we love.

Take Apple, for instance. They’ve got a massive fan base. According to a report by Consumer Intelligence Research Partners, around 90% of iPhone users are pretty happy with their devices. And you can guess what that means—accessory sales for them are through the roof! Stuff like cases, screen protectors, and those fancy chargers, whether they’re from Apple or reliable third-party brands, really catch the eye of loyal customers. This kind of loyalty highlights how important it is to stick with a brand; it gives us that warm fuzzy feeling knowing we’re buying accessories that fit perfectly with our trusted devices.

Plus, the whole brand loyalty thing goes way beyond just choosing what to buy; it’s about perceived value and trust too. A survey by Deloitte showed that 55% of folks prefer to purchase accessories from the same brand as their primary smartphone. They mentioned quality, compatibility, and customer service as big reasons for their choices. It’s funny how we tend to think branded accessories mean better quality and functionality, huh? That just strengthens our loyalty in the accessory market. So, for brands, it’s crucial to keep those good relationships going with their customers. After all, brand loyalty not only shapes our accessory decisions but also drives our buying habits in such a competitive landscape.

Emerging Accessory Technologies: What the Future Holds for Smartphone Users

Hey, have you noticed how fast smartphone accessories are changing these days? I mean, it's wild! Thanks to tech innovations and what users really want, the accessories market is going to blow up, with projections suggesting it’ll hit over $100 billion by 2025, according to a report from Grand View Research. People are just craving new and cool gadgets! With all these new accessory technologies coming in, our smartphone experience is getting a major upgrade.

One of the coolest things happening right now is the surge in wireless charging tech. It’s getting super efficient, too! A study by the Wireless Power Consortium found that more than 80% of folks prefer going wireless because, honestly, who doesn’t love a bit of convenience? Plus, there's this great feature called reverse wireless charging, which lets you power up other devices right from your phone. How neat is that? It definitely adds a new level of versatility to how we use our accessories.

And let’s not forget about the growing trend of smart wearables syncing up with smartphones. Statista estimates that by 2025, the wearable tech market will go past $60 billion. Gadgets like smartwatches and fitness trackers are not just enhancing what our phones can do, but they’re also making the whole user experience way smoother. The ability to control your phone directly from your smartwatch is a game changer, showing how these devices are really coming together in our hyper-connected world. It definitely opens up a ton of possibilities for accessories that focus on making life easier and more accessible for everyone.
